Everything Was Beautiful, the ninth album by Jason Pierce’s space rock powerhouse Spiritualized, was crafted over the course of the Covid-19 pandemic. Though multiple of the songs have existed for some time, (case in point, Always Together With You which was released as a demo on 2014’s The Space Project) the lockdown period gave Pierce the solitude he needed to coalesce the project into a single whole. The album has been described as a “sonic forest” of rich sound in the tradition of previous albums; critically, it has had a strongly positive response. The band has refined “orchestral space rock into an alchemical power that goes beyond concerns about novelty” (Pitchfork), “revelling in ecstatic keyboards and orchestral wallops”(The Guardian) to form a “strung-out church music and frazzled classic rock and free-jazz affectations and psychedelia both classicist and futuristic all blending together in an aesthetic that feels like a cosmic transmission”(Stereogum).
The title Everything Was Beautiful completes the Kurt Vonnegut-quoting title of And Nothing Hurt from his novel Slaughterhouse-Five.
